Every Repetitive Question Costs Your Business Money
Think about how many times your team answers questions like:
• Where’s my order?
• Do you ship internationally?
• What’s included in your pricing?
• How can I reset my password?
None of these questions require deep expertise.
Yet they consume hours every single day.
This is where chatbots for customer care create immediate value.
Instead of spending valuable employee time on repetitive conversations, AI handles them instantly, allowing your team to focus on customers who genuinely need human assistance.
The result isn’t just faster support.
It’s a more productive support team.

AI Makes Human Agents Better
One of the biggest misconceptions is that AI replaces customer support teams.
The best businesses use AI differently.
AI handles repetitive conversations.
Humans handle emotional, technical, and high-value interactions.
When a conversation becomes too complex, AI transfers it with the complete conversation history, allowing the agent to continue immediately.
Customers don’t repeat themselves.
Agents don’t waste time gathering context.
Everyone wins.

Choosing the Right AI Chatbot for Customer Service
Not every AI chatbot delivers the same value.
Look for a solution that can:
• Learn from your business knowledge
• Answer questions naturally
• Escalate conversations to human agents
• Capture leads
• Support multiple languages
• Integrate with your existing tools
• Continuously improve through feedback
The right platform doesn’t just answer questions—it becomes an extension of your customer support team.
